EARTH FREAKS!
The Royal 330 Baker Street Nelson, BC V1L 4H5, Nelson, British Columbia, CanadaSince forming in 2021, Earth Freaks have worked at a feverish rate and continued to push themselves in a fashion that can be described as nothing short of miraculous. The four piece, which trained at Selkirk College’s renowned music program, has shown no signs of slowing down from the time of its inception. A jam-packed […]